Outpatient Detoxification - Alcohol and Drug Rehabilitation Programs - St. Olaf, IA.

If someone is getting outpatient detox they travel to the facility helping them through detoxification every day or at minimum five days a week in most cases. Outpatient detoxification services are either delivered in the evening or daytime, which makes it ideal for someone who must maintain a normal work or school routine. Certain facilities may also offer ways to participate in treatment in a choice of regular outpatient or outpatient day treatment, to improve detox services and prevent relapse.

An average time people remain in outpatient detox is about seven days. A number of facilities use medically assisted detox methods while others provide medication free detoxification services. At times when meds are necessary to prevent life threatening withdrawal problems, as is the case with alcohol and benzodiazepine medications where seizures are sometimes an issue. Alternatively, medical staff at the facility help people handle their emotional, psychological, and physical symptoms of withdrawal and cravings until they are detoxified and stabilized.

While outpatient detoxification in St. Olaf is more adaptable for obvious reasons, a serious disadvantage is that individuals are at a greater chance of relapse due to the access they keep to drugs and alcohol. Ideally, individuals will then go into a log-term or short-term recovery program to deal with the reasons for their addiction once outpatient or inpatient detox is finished.
